This is a review of the Zorki 4k and usage made in the USSR in 1976.
The Zorki-4K is fundamentally a Zorki-4 with the expansion of a repaired take spool and a film advance switch rather than the knurled handle. The KMZ logo was moved to one side so it would not be secured by the development switch and leave space for an elastic switch stop. Its standard focal points are M39 screw mount Jupiter-8 50mm f/2 or Industar-50 50mm f/3.5. Shade is fabric even central plane with speed 1-1/1000 +B.
